Well, it was a grandstand finish at Wembley, but Liverpool were by a long way the better of the two sides. Spurs were poor. This really could have been a mauling and Klopp will be concerned by how many chances his team passed up. But Liverpool have five wins from five and that's all that matters in the end.

GO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OAL! Spurs 1 (93 mins - Erik Lamela) Liverpool 2. A nervy finish for Liverpool? They allowed a corner kick to bounce all the way to the back post, where Lamela took it on his chest and fired a low volley into the corner of the net. Spurs have given themselves a chance here! Is it too late?
